Output 28b905930fa2788e367f53d2d1cddc1324c6101f20c1fd68c1beb24d528d8fcd:166

value
3916918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e03ab2c1de5e5f618fed4c0930d5cf4e57250a OP_EQUAL
address
MPJ6NP6zHe88wx1z8KoJLckxpERH1ogLfP
transaction
28b905930fa2788e367f53d2d1cddc1324c6101f20c1fd68c1beb24d528d8fcd
spent
true